248 Minster Court, Liverpool, L7 3QH is a leasehold terraced property built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 614 square feet of living space and is situated on the 2nd floor. In this location, properties of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£178,293 , which equates to approximately £291 per square foot. It was last sold on 27 Mar 2002 for £40,500. Since then, the value has increased by £137,793, representing a 340.2% increase, or approximately 14.3% per year.

The current estimated value of £178,293 is:

  • 29.5% higher than the average property price on Minster Court
  • 29.2% higher than the average in the L7 3QH postcode area
  • and 28.4% lower than the average price for Liverpool as a whole

EPC Summary

248 Minster Court, Liverpool, Merseyside, L7 3QH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 18 Oct 2013.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are single gl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 4 Sep 2013.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 6.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, partial ins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
